Kivonat:My research paper focuses on finding a correlation between a series of theories in connection with social movements, especially the ones that oppose technological advancements. The focal point of my interest lies in the connection between progress and masses disputing technological growth, moreover, the way they communicate their concerns. The leading question which awaits answering is whether we can progressively resist progress or are just moving in circles when it comes to protesting. In the first part of the paper, I will provide a literature review and introduce various theories regarding group behaviour, communal communication, social movement theory. I will look at historical instances and analyze them based on said theories, to wholly understand the notion behind these movements. Upon arriving in modern days, I will inspect social movements regarding Artificial Intelligence, which will conclude the research part of my paper. Methodically, my paper consists of secondary research paired with comprehensive content analysis from various fields, which will help me find a correlation between the observed topics, and ultimately paint a coherent and all-encompassing picture. With sufficient information, a conclusion will be drawn, which is designed to answer my research question and help us understand the source, forms and communication of these social movements, furthermore, whether we can see periodic repetition to a degree when it comes to social movements.
